Tokyo 2020 will not take place this year as the International Olympic Committee has postponed the event due to the coronavirus pandemic and the ITF has backed the decision.
There will now be a vacant slot in the 2020 tennis calendar after the Tokyo Games decision, but the All England Club has made it clear they are not interested in rescheduling Wimbledon.
Next Generation star Thiago Seyboth Wild has become the first tennis player to reveal he has tested positive for the coronavirus.

This US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center surface will undergo an upgrade ahead of this year’s US Open with organisers confirming they will use the new Laykold courts made by Advanced Polymer Technology.
“Laykold courts are the only courts with vapor barrier designed specifically for the court system, which also greatly increases consistency in both court performance and court speed,” a statement on usopen.org read.
Aidan McHugh has spoken about the physical and mental effects that the lockdown due the coronavirus will have on him (and basically most tennis players).
“Mentally it is a weird one because normally we can see what we’re playing next. Even in pre-season, that’s the longest time where you get five weeks of good, hard training, but then you know what week you’re starting, whether this is unknown because things are changing every day,” he told PA Sport (via Daily Mail).
“I think you’ve just got to look at it to try and improve yourself physically and work on your game where you can.”
